Terrane
In geology, the terrane is a crust of the crust material, which is formed on a plate, or from a plate, and later proliferated (or called "suture") to another plate. At this time, the crust block or debris still retains its own unique history, and the surrounding area is different (therefore, occasionally with the term terrestrial). The suture between the terrane and its attached crust is usually a fault. ...
